Abstract

The invention relates to a lubricating agent for reducing the wear between the railroad rails and train wheels, wherein the production raw materials include molybdenum sulfide, silver powder, polytetrafluoroethylene, graphite fluoride, zinc orthophosphate, and graphite. The lubricating agent is produced by mixing the components and processing through the common synthesizing method, which integrates the functions of chemical adsorption, physical adsorption and organic film covering.

Description

The steel rail wear-reducing dry type extreme-pressure agent
One, technical field
The present invention is a kind of lubricant that weares and teares between railway track and train wheel that reduces.
Two, background technology
Increase along with railway transporting amount and rate of traffic flow, especially since the train speed-raising, the side grinding of curved steel rail, the abrasion of couble crossover are on the rise, can increase the maintenance cost of circuit like this and influence traffic safety, now use grease anti-attrition poor adhesive force, time is short, develops that a kind of anti-attrition is long-acting, to spread upon the rail friction surface be a problem demanding prompt solution to the extreme pressure lubricant of safe ready.
Three, summary of the invention
The objective of the invention is to make a kind of be in operation steel rail wear-reducing lubricant of big load between wheel and the rail, high-speed, long-time powerful friction of train that adapts to.
The weight percent of making used various raw materials is curing aluminium 3-5%, silver powder 3-4%, tetrafluoroethylene 4-5%, fluorographite 8-10%, zinc phosphate 2-3%, paraffin 73-80%.Manufacture craft is synthesis technique commonly used.
This lubricant has reached the effect that chemisorption, physical adsorption, organic membrane hide three unifications, can be trapped in the rail friction surface for a long time effectively, anti-extreme pressure, be specially adapted to big load, high-speed occasion, phenomenon takes place to prevent engine burn, sintering, peel off etc., and rail can prolong 8-10 doubly work-ing life.Do not pollute in the production process, do not produce the three wastes.Free from environmental pollution during use.
Four, embodiment
Example 1. production technique of the present invention are easy, paraffin uses 62# refined wax the best, claim system with raw materials by weight, at first 80% paraffin is put into the reactor that band stirs, be warming up to about 120 ℃, stirring down, order adds 3% molybdenumdisulphide, 3% silver powder, 8% fluorographite, 4% tetrafluoroethylene, 2% zinc phosphate.Stir about 1 hour is cooled to about 80 ℃, the steel membrane moulding of under agitation casting, cooling back packing.
Example 2. is put into the reactor that band stirs with 73% paraffin, is warming up to about 120 ℃, and stirring down, order adds 5% molybdenumdisulphide, 4% silver powder, 10% fluorographite, 5% tetrafluoroethylene, 3% zinc phosphate.Stir about 1 hour is cooled to about 80 ℃, the steel membrane moulding of under agitation casting, cooling back packing.

Claims (1)

1, steel rail wear-reducing dry type extreme-pressure agent is characterized in that: the weight ratio of making used various raw materials is: molybdenumdisulphide 3-5%, silver powder 3-4%, tetrafluoroethylene 4-5%, fluorographite 8-10%, zinc phosphate 2-3%, paraffin 73-80%.
